I love both of these things so it was an easy creation for me to make. I used a 12x12 thin canvas for this one as I knew there would be lots of medium and didn't want warpy paper!

"Make a Difference"

I was heavily influenced by the prompt for the challenge. I not only loved the cracked paint surfaces but I also loved the colours. 


 I incorporated some of the Colored Grit LIGHT BLUE into the project as well as some Natural Mica Flakes LIGHT GOLD to create texture.
I also plastered on some Ayeeda Medium Modeling Paste. I allowed it to dry as much as I could before spraying some of the Ayeeda Mists Chalk over it. When I then hit it with the heat gun to dry the mists, it dried with a crackled effect!
 Then I added some Ayeeda Paint Matte Caramel Matte Cobalt Matte Turquoise over the top in sections to paint my chippy and to add another layer of colour.

 The sprays I used were Ayeeda Mists Chalk IndigoChalk UntramarineChalk Yellow Amber and Pastel Turquoise. These colours worked a treat together.
